New Year's eve is quickly approaching! Now is the time to start thinking about your New Year's eve dress, if you don't already have a sparkly number picked out and hanging in your closet.

Tips for picking the perfect New Year's eve dress

  • Consider location - will you be hanging out at a house party, attending a gala or going clubbing? Certain styles might make more sense depending on your plans. However on New Year's eve, you can always be dressier than the location dictates. If you like sequins, wear them... even if you're just headed to a local dive bar.
  • Decide on a budget - is this a dress you will wear over and over again? If so, you can afford to spend a little more, which does translate into quality and fit. If you purchase a classic little black dress like the Lauren Ralph Lauren dress #3 above, you can shell out a little more cash with the assurance you can wear the dress to multiple functions for years. But if you're looking for a sparkly number that you might only wear once, definitely check out a less expensive brand like Forever 21. Charlotte Russe also has plus size dresses at bargain prices.
  • Ignore trends - It's fun to be stylish and on-trend, but the point I'm trying to make is that it's more important for the dress to look good on you! Different styles flatter different body types. If the it-dress of the moment doesn't flatter your curves, keep looking. Don't be afraid to try on a dress that looks ugly on the hanger, you would be surprised how often I've LOVED something I tried on that initially I didn't even like.

What to pack in your purse

Don't forget these essentials for New Year's eve

  1. Mints or gum - every gal needs fresh breath on New Year's eve
  2. Lipstick or gloss - touch ups will be necessary
  3. Cash - cab fare or something unexpected, it's just a good idea
  4. ID and credit card - obvious, but necessary 
  5. Foldable flats - if you're wearing high heels
  6. Hand sanitizer - stay germ free
  7. Tylenol - in case you get a headache
  8. Kleenex - they just come in handy
  9. Ear plugs - stash a pair just in case
  10. Smartphone - doubles as your camera too
